**Q: Why does my plugin's output get sanitized differently in the Thistledown markdown pipeline?**

A: Thistledown renders in three passes: parse, plugin transform, then sanitize. Anything your plugin injects after the transform pass is treated as untrusted and stripped, so emit nodes through the official AST hooks rather than raw HTML. If your plugin needs to test against the locked staging renderer, the sandbox bootstrap will prompt for credentials and then ask you to enter the phrase below.

vault phrase of yagag-kadup = belael-druius-rusax-kelox

**Fan-out Backpressure (Brindlehook Notify)**

When a notification fan-out exceeds the per-plugin delivery budget, Brindlehook Notify applies backpressure by returning a 429 with a `X-Drain-After` header rather than dropping events. Plugin authors should pause enqueueing until the drain window elapses, then resume at half the prior rate. To inspect your current budget and queue depth, call the internal quota service, authenticating with the key below:

app token of hawif-yaguf = kto15_D1YHEykrtxKxx7V

## Changelog — Quillgrid 3.2

User-supplied formulas now run sandboxed by default. Previously the evaluator ran in-process with full interpreter access; that's gone. New installs get the restricted runtime, a 200ms eval timeout, and no filesystem or network builtins. Upgrades inherit the old behavior only if explicitly pinned. If a tenant's formulas break, check the sandbox denial log before escalating. The defaults that ship with 3.2 are as follows.

settings of kajep-kajop:
OLIDOR_LOG_LEVEL=info
OLIDOR_METRICS_HOST=metrics.olidor.norvacorp.corp
OLIDOR_POOL_SIZE=4

// REINDEX_BATCH_CAP limits docs per shard pass in the Tallowfield
// nightly search reindex. Raising it starves the ingest queue;
// lowering it overruns the maintenance window. 5000 is the tested
// sweet spot. Change only with a soak run. Verified against the
// build noted below.

session token of bawif-hahog = htk6_ac5981